Location

Hotel Champlain is situated in the historic center of Old Quebec,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Guests can explore the quaint Petit-Champlain district, the majestic Château Frontenac, and the well-preserved ramparts within walking distance. The hotel's location allows for easy access to cultural treasures, museums, and seasonal festivities throughout the year.

Accommodations

Hotel Champlain presents 53 rooms thoughtfully designed with a blend of modern elements and historic charm. Guests can choose from various room types, including Superior Charm of Yesteryear and King Suite with Kitchen, specifically catering to different travel needs. The hotel retained its historic character while integrating contemporary comforts across its accommodations.

Dining

A hot and cold breakfast buffet is served daily at Hotel Champlain, featuring diverse options to energize guests for their day. The breakfast room highlights the warm heritage charm that complements the hotel's historical ambiance. An electronic wine bar is available near the reception for guests preferring to unwind with a refreshing drink.

Amenities

Hotel Champlain enhances guest experiences with a 24-hour espresso bar featuring complimentary drinking options. The lobby includes a cozy fireplace, providing a space for social interaction and relaxation after a day of city exploration. The hotel offers secure outdoor parking on-site, ensuring peace of mind for those traveling by car.

Family-Friendly and Pet Policies

Hotel Champlain provides family-friendly accommodations, including spacious Deluxe rooms that suit small families seeking comfort. Guests are welcome to bring their four-legged companions, with designated policies in place for pets. The hotel also offers baby cribs upon request, catering to families traveling with young children.

Property information and rules
Check-in
from 16:00-23:59
Check-out
until 11 am
Guest Parking
Public parking is possible on site (reservation might be needed) at CAD 25 per day.
Internet
is available in for free.
Breakfast
The hotel offers a full breakfast at the price of CAD 14.95 per person per day. 
Children & extra beds
There are no extra beds provided in a room.  There are no cots provided in a room. 
Pets
Pets are allowed on request.
Year renovated:
2006
Number of floors:
5
Number of rooms:
51
